Cong Manifesto Expresses Voice Of Deprived Sections Of Society, Says Babita Sharma In Bhubaneswar

Bhubaneswar: The election manifesto of Congress is an expression of the deprived and exploited sections of the society, said the party’s media cell coordinator Babita Sharma on Sunday.

Speaking to media persons in Bhubaneswar, Babita said the party’s manifesto has been prepared with inputs collected by Rahul Gandhi from the people during his Bharat Jodo Nyay Yatra.

“It is not only a manifesto but the voice of the deprived sections of the society. The Congress has made promises to ensure justice to 5 sections of society including youths, women, farmers, labourers and deprived,” she said.

The party has promised to launch a Mahalakshmi scheme across the country under which it will provide 1 lakh per year to the oldest woman member of every poor family as an “unconditional cash transfer”.

It has also assured of 10% reservation in jobs and educational institutions for Economically Weaker Sections (EWS) of all castes and communities without discrimination, if elected to power in the Lok Sabha elections.

For the farmers, the party has promised waiver of farm loans, guarantee of MSP for their crop, compensation for crop loss within 30 days and abolition of GST on farm products.
